Host Marc Mallett, speaks with Carl Tannenbaum, Chief Economist at Northern Trust, about what 2025 holds for the global economy. Carl unpacks the major trends that defined 2024 and shares key themes that he expects to take shape in 2025.
Key Highlights:
The influence and ramifications of 2024 global elections on economies
How immigration policies around the world may impact productivity and economic growth with a new regime in many countries
The delicate dance with inflation and its ripple effects on major economies, analyzing the ongoing impact of inflationary pressures and interest rate adjustments
